A FORMER pupil of Yeoford Primary School and Queen Elizabeth's Community College, Crediton, has raised more than £1,350 for Save the Children UK and achieved a personal best in this year's London Marathon. Dan Ezard completed the run in three hours 26 minutes, beating his own time from last year by 15 minutes. Crediton supporters of Save the Children also raised almost £225 in Save the Children Week with a collection at Tesco Crediton Wellparks store last Friday. Sue Brown, who organised the collection, thanked all the helpers as well as Tesco for their support.
